Understanding G Router Wireless Channels

Before we dive into the specifics, it's essential to understand the basics of wireless channels. Wi-Fi routers operate on two primary frequency bands: 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z. The 2.4 GHz band is more prone to interference from other devices, while the 5 GHz band offers faster speeds but with a shorter range. Understanding Channel Interference

Channel interference occurs when multiple devices operating on the same channel overlap and cause congestion. This can lead to slowed data transfer rates, dropped connections, and other WiFi-related issues. To mitigate this, it's essential to understand the channel layout and choose the best available channel for your router.
